Storyline
• Flight, jan 1989, Heathrow to Belfast, Midland 192
• Experienced pilots, new plane (737)
• Part of one of the safest systems in the world
• Upon take-off, no problems
• Shuddering, fire in an engine at ~10 min.
• Shut off #2 engine, RHS (the good one!)
• This is the pilot error
Hardware and Mischancebadly designed new engine, failure at 3 months,
approx. t=300 h, should be t=500,000 h, not tested at altitude
/unlucky choice of diversion airport [BMI hub]
Auto throttle problem
poor mental model of plane [system](turned off good engine, which disengaged autothrottled, solving the judder problem)
lack of engine feedback [interface design]
Vibration Dial 1
vibration dial harder to read [design]
vibration dial not required to fly [regulation]
dial and plane not trained with simulator
technology updated but not announced
Vibration Dial 2
vibration dial small [design]
Without range marking [design]
During descent
lots of interruptions
pilots can’t see the engines
no protocol: no checking/confirmation visually from cabin
• Passengers could see fire but explained it away, perhaps also flight attendantsdiffusion of social responsibilities
Social distance between aircrew and pilots
crash
• 900 m short
• 43+4 out of 118+8 die
